[QUOTE="davewilson, post: 444654, member: 4491"] i think any of the scopes mentioned will work, i would just recommend a BDC type of reticle especially for shooting coyotes. they're not exactly a sit around and get a good shot at me kinda animal. i'm partial to a reticle hold for shots under 600 for hunting big game. over that, start crankin the turrets. guess i'll cast my vote for the viper,i recently bought one of the 6-20's and can say i'm very impressed with it's performance.
